systemcomposer.analysis. Экземпляр

Класс, который представляет элемент модели архитектуры в аналитическом экземпляре

Описание

Класс Instance представляет экземпляр архитектуры.

Создание

Создайте экземпляр архитектуры

instance = instantiate(modelHandle,architecture,properties,name)

Свойства

развернуть все

Это - имя экземпляра.

Типы данных: char

Каждый экземпляр имеет спецификацию, от которой он принял свою форму. Вид спецификации зависит от вида экземпляра.

Типы данных: systemcomposer.arch.Architecture | systemcomposer.arch.Component | systemcomposer.arch.Port | systemcomposer.arch.Connector

Свойства экземпляра архитектуры

Компоненты в архитектуре.

Типы данных: systemcomposer.analysis.ComponentInstance

Это порты архитектуры, которые принадлежат экземпляру архитектуры.

Типы данных: systemcomposer.analysis.PortInstance

Это коннекторы в архитектуре, соединяя дочерние компоненты.

Типы данных: systemcomposer.analysis.Connectors

Свойства экземпляра компонента

Компоненты в архитектуре.

Типы данных: systemcomposer.analysis.ComponentInstance

Это порты архитектуры, которые принадлежат экземпляру архитектуры.

Типы данных: systemcomposer.analysis.PortInstance

Это коннекторы в архитектуре, соединяя дочерние компоненты.

Типы данных: systemcomposer.analysis.Connectors

Архитектура, которая содержит компонент

Типы данных: systemcomposer.analysis.Architecture

Свойства экземпляра порта

Компонент, который содержит порт

Типы данных: systemcomposer.analysis.Component

Свойства экземпляра коннектора

Компонент, который содержит коннектор

Типы данных: systemcomposer.analysis.Component

Порт, из которого происходит коннектор.

Типы данных: systemcomposer.analysis.Port

Порт, от которого заканчивается коннектор.

Типы данных: systemcomposer.analysis.Port

Функции объекта

deleteInstanceУдалите экземпляр архитектуры
getValueПолучите значение свойства от экземпляра элемента
instantiateСоздайте аналитический экземпляр из спецификации
isArchitectureНайдите, является ли экземпляр экземпляром архитектуры
isComponentНайдите, является ли экземпляр экземпляром компонента
isConnectorНайдите, является ли экземпляр экземпляром коннектора
isPortНайдите, является ли экземпляр экземпляром порта
loadInstanceЗагрузите экземпляр архитектуры
saveInstanceСохраните экземпляр архитектуры
setValueУстановите значение свойства для экземпляра элемента
updateInstanceОбновите экземпляр архитектуры

Введенный в R2019a

Для просмотра документации необходимо авторизоваться на сайте